I've done threads on these before so will not be super detailed here. This batch is made up from any scraps that happened to be big enough to yield parts. I unloaded one rack off tha wall to use as a guide.
Laying out a bunch of the arm parts you can see how varied the source material is .
I drill a bunch of holes for the "dowel nuts" that my design uses.
I can't find my bandsaw sled so I cobbled a quick one together with a groove for holding round stock.
Just like sliced bread.
I glue the dowel pieces in with the grain perpendicular to the screw that will be used.
I'll let these set up a bit and move along.
